What Are Screwless Dental Implants and How Do They Work?
Screwless dental implants represent a revolutionary advancement in dental technology, differing significantly from traditional screw-type implants. Instead of using a threaded screw design that requires drilling and twisting into the jawbone, screwless implants utilise a smooth, tapered design that’s gently inserted into the bone socket. This innovative approach promotes faster healing and reduces trauma to surrounding tissues. The implant surface features advanced biocompatible coatings that encourage natural bone integration, creating a stable foundation for artificial teeth without the mechanical stress associated with traditional screws.
Why Are Screwless Solutions Better Than Traditional Methods?
The advantages of screwless dental implants extend far beyond comfort. Traditional screw-type implants can create micro-fractures in the jawbone during insertion, potentially leading to complications and extended healing periods. Screwless alternatives eliminate this risk by preserving the natural bone structure. Patients typically experience less post-operative pain, minimal swelling, and faster recovery times. The elimination of threading also reduces the risk of implant failure due to mechanical loosening, a concern that occasionally affects traditional implants over time. Additionally, the simplified insertion process often allows for immediate loading, meaning temporary teeth can be placed on the same day.

How Long Do Screwless Implants Last Compared to Traditional Options?
Longevity is a crucial consideration for any dental implant investment. While screwless dental implants are relatively new compared to traditional implants, early research and clinical data suggest comparable or superior longevity. The absence of threaded components eliminates potential points of mechanical failure, while the smooth surface design promotes better long-term bone integration. Traditional implants have a success rate of approximately 95% over 10-15 years, and preliminary data indicates screwless alternatives may achieve similar or better outcomes. The key difference lies in the reduced risk of peri-implantitis and bone loss around the implant site, potentially extending the overall lifespan of the restoration.

Understanding the Cost Landscape of Screwless Dental Implants
The financial aspect of screwless dental implants varies significantly across Australia, with several factors influencing pricing. Location, practitioner experience, and specific implant systems all impact costs. While screwless technology was initially more expensive than traditional methods, increased adoption has made pricing more competitive.
| Treatment Type | Provider Category | Cost Estimation (AUD) |
|---|---|---|
| Single Screwless Implant | Major City Specialist | $3,500 - $5,500 |
| Single Screwless Implant | Regional Practitioner | $2,800 - $4,200 |
| Full Mouth Screwless System | Specialist Clinic | $15,000 - $25,000 |
| All-on-4 Screwless Solution | Experienced Practitioner | $12,000 - $20,000 |
